CM Revanth launches Hydraa site tomorrow

Hyderabad:The long-awaited Hydraa Police Department will be unveiled on May 8 by Chief Minister Revanth Reddy. Located next to Hydraa headquarters in Bhavan, the station will form an ACP, six inspectors, 12 deputy inspectors and 30 police officers. It will have 70 cars including mini roundtrip, motorcycles, cars and Wissings.
Hydraa recruited about 150 people who nearly missed the police officer exam. They will be appointed as the Hydraa's Traffic Wing, while some of them will be appointed as the DRF team.
Officials said the police station's structural works have been completed and gave the house a final step. Union Minister G. Kishan Reddy, Deputy Chief Minister Malu Bhatti Vikramarka, Ministers Ponnam Prabhakar and Sridhar Babu will attend the inauguration.
